Grammar
Right down grammar for C-Like syntax
Function Type identifier ( ArgList ) CompoundStmt
ArgList Arg | ArgList ,Arg
Arg Type identifier
Declaration Type IdentList ;
Type int | float
IdentList identifier ,IdentList | identifier
Stmt WhileStmt | Rvalue ; | IfStmt
| CompoundStmt | Declaration |;
WhileStmt while (Rvalue ) Stmt
IfStmt if (Rvalue ) Stmt ElsePart
ElsePart else Stmt |
CompoundStmt { StmtList }
StmtList StmtList Stmt |
Rvalue Rvalue Compare Mag | Mag
Compare == | < | > | <= | >= | != | <>
Mag Mag + Term | Mag – Term | Term
Term Term * Factor | Term / Factor | Factor
Factor ( Expr ) | identifier | number
